Active Ingredients in Acne Treatment Products

Alcohol and Acetone. Alcohols and Acetones are often found in acne skin care cleansers and astringents. They are effective in clearing skin of dirt and oils. These products can sting or burn the skin when applied.

Benzoyl Peroxide. This extremely common ingredient is found in many over the counter acne skin care products. It prevents comedones by clearing skin of dead skin cells. It is basically an anti-bacterial ingredient that helps remove bacteria in the follicles. A common side effect is skin dryness and sometimes scaling.

Salicylic Acid. Salicylic acid is successful in treating acne lesions that are non-inflammatory. It corrects the abnormal flaking of skin cells and can unclog pores to treat and prevent acne blemishes. Salicylic acid is not effective in killing P. acne bacteria nor controlling sebum production. Products containing salicylic acid can be irritating for some people.

Sulfur. Sulfur exists in acne skin care products often in combination with other active ingredients, such as salicylic acid, alcohol, or resorcinol. It can help in clearing the skin of dead skin cells and excess oil. Products with sulfur can cause dryness and soreness usually at the start of treatment.

Treatment Options for the Removal of Acne Scars

Dermabrasion. Dermabrasion is a procedure that uses a machine with diamond edged wheels that quickly rotate. The type of wheel that is used and how coarse it is determines the effects of the treatment. Dermabrasion can be effective in improving shallow imperfections, but will do little to reduce deeper scars. These types of procedures usually run around 1500 dollars.

Laser Resurfacing. These procedures use lasers to remove the top layers of skin to allow new skin to form in its place. Lasers can more easily control the exact depth of penetration you wish to treat your skin. Laser treatments are most effective in treating shallow imperfections and usually go for around 3000 dollars per treatment.

Chemical Peels. This option consists of applying different types of acid in order to burn off top layers of skin so a smoother layer can surface. Chemical peels are designed to improve minimal cases of scarring, not severe scarring. This procedure costs around 750 dollars.

Subcision. This treatment is to detach the scar from the deeper skin tissue which allows a blood clot to form below the scar. This clot aids in forming connective tissues underneath the scar in order to level it with the skin surface. This option is often combine with resurfacing. More than one treatment is often necessary and prices per treatment can vary.
